SEO & ORGANIC SEARCH

When Your Website Is Not Getting the Search Visibility It Needs

A website can look good and still struggle to attract relevant organic traffic. Search visibility may be limited by technical issues, weak page relevance, unclear search intent, missing content opportunities or pages that do not give searchers the answers they need.

COMMON SEO CHALLENGES

NOT SHOWING FOR IMPORTANT SEARCHES

Important Pages Are Hard to Find in Search

Relevant services or pages may not appear prominently when potential customers search for the topics, problems or solutions the business wants to be discovered for.

TRAFFIC WITHOUT THE RIGHT INTENT

Traffic Is Coming, but It Is Not Relevant Enough

Organic visits are more useful when pages match the questions, needs and commercial intent behind the searches bringing people to the website.

COMPETITORS ARE MORE VISIBLE

Competitors Keep Appearing Above Your Pages

Competitors may have stronger page relevance, better topic coverage, clearer site structure or other search signals that make their pages more competitive.

TECHNICAL ISSUES LIMIT DISCOVERY

Technical Problems Can Hold Important Pages Back

Indexability, crawlability, internal linking, page structure, speed and other technical factors can affect how efficiently search engines discover and understand website content.

CONTENT DOES NOT ANSWER ENOUGH

Pages Do Not Fully Address What Searchers Need

Pages that describe a service without answering real questions, concerns and search intent may miss opportunities to rank for useful long-tail and problem-based searches.

GOOGLE ADS

When Paid Search Gets Clicks but Not Enough Results

Google Ads can generate immediate visibility, but traffic alone does not make a campaign effective. Poor targeting, weak keyword intent, mismatched landing pages or incomplete tracking can make it difficult to understand which spend is actually helping the business.

COMMON GOOGLE ADS PROBLEMS

CLICKS WITHOUT ENOUGH ENQUIRIES

People Click the Ads but Do Not Take the Next Step

Campaign traffic may reach the website without producing enough meaningful actions when the keyword, ad message, landing page and visitor intent are not aligned closely enough.

TOO MUCH IRRELEVANT TRAFFIC

Budget Is Being Spent on the Wrong Searches

Broad or poorly controlled targeting can bring visitors whose searches do not match the service, audience or commercial intent the campaign is meant to reach.

COSTS ARE RISING

The Cost of Acquiring a Lead Keeps Increasing

Campaign efficiency can decline when competition, targeting, bidding, ad relevance or landing-page performance changes without the account being reviewed and adjusted.

TRACKING IS UNCLEAR

It Is Hard to Tell Which Campaigns Are Actually Working

Without reliable conversion actions and campaign measurement, it becomes harder to understand which keywords, ads and audiences are contributing to useful business outcomes.

META ADS

When Paid Social Reaches People but Does Not Create Enough Action

Meta Ads can reach large and highly targeted audiences, but reach alone does not make a campaign effective. Audience selection, creative, messaging, campaign objectives, landing-page experience and measurement all influence what happens after someone sees an ad.

COMMON META ADS PROBLEMS

REACH WITHOUT RESPONSE

Ads Are Reaching People but Not Creating Enough Action

A campaign may generate impressions or clicks without enough useful next steps when the audience, message, creative or offer does not connect strongly with what people need.

CREATIVE STOPS WORKING

The Same Ads Lose Impact Over Time

Campaign performance can change as audiences see the same creative repeatedly, making ongoing creative review and testing an important part of paid social management.

AUDIENCE TARGETING IS TOO BROAD OR TOO NARROW

Campaigns Are Not Reaching the Right Mix of People

Audience definitions, exclusions, remarketing groups and campaign objectives can influence whether advertising reaches people who are relevant to the intended goal.

CLICKS DO NOT TURN INTO CONVERSIONS

The Experience After the Ad Does Not Match the Message

People may engage with an ad but leave after clicking when the landing page, offer, content or conversion path does not continue the expectation created by the campaign.

ANALYTICS & CONVERSION TRACKING

When Marketing Is Running but You Cannot Clearly See What Is Working

Marketing data is most useful when it connects channel activity with meaningful website actions. Without a clear tracking structure, teams may see traffic, clicks and engagement while still struggling to understand which campaigns are contributing to enquiries, calls or other important outcomes.

COMMON MEASUREMENT PROBLEMS

TRAFFIC WITHOUT CONTEXT

You Can See Visitors but Not What They Actually Do

Traffic numbers alone do not explain whether visitors call, submit forms, reach important pages or complete the actions the marketing strategy is intended to support.

CONVERSIONS ARE NOT TRACKED CLEARLY

Important Calls and Enquiries Are Difficult to Attribute

When conversion actions are missing, duplicated or configured inconsistently, it becomes harder to understand which channels and campaigns are contributing to useful customer actions.

DIFFERENT PLATFORMS TELL DIFFERENT STORIES

Marketing Reports Do Not Always Agree

Advertising, analytics and website platforms can measure activity differently, so reporting should be reviewed with an understanding of what each system is actually recording.

ACTIVITY IS REPORTED WITHOUT ENOUGH MEANING

Reports Show Numbers but Do Not Answer the Business Question

Clicks, impressions and sessions provide useful context, but reporting becomes more valuable when it also reflects the actions and outcomes that matter to the business.
